Dharwad: A 45-year-old doctor was stabbed to death at his residence in Dharwad Wednesday night, while his eight-year-old mentally challenged son was found severely injured.The deceased has been identified as Dr Kiran Honnannanavar, an anaesthesiologist at a private hospital. He was stabbed multiple times at his flat in Ranka Stello Apartment on Karnatak University Road. Police shifted him to a hospital.Dr Kiran lived with his wife, Dr Priyanka Gaddanahalli, an ophthalmologist, and their son Nihit, said police commissioner N Shashikumar. “It is not clear when the murder happened. We found that Nihit was alive in the pool of blood, and we shifted him to the hospital immediately.”He added, “Dr Kiran’s relatives and friends were allegedly calling him on Tuesday night and Wednesday, and Dr Priya answered those calls, saying he was busy or that he had gone to the hospital. When neighbours called her, she allegedly said she was home, and her husband had gone out. The reason for the incident is yet to be ascertained. Currently, Dr Priyanka is in shock. She said that she was sitting at home in shock. However, her words are confusing at this moment. Nihit is said to be mentally challenged. We have registered a murder case. Dr Kiran’s family members are alleging that Dr Priyanka is behind the crime. We will take a complaint from them. We have detained her.”He added, “The apartment has a very secure atmosphere. Each house has CCTV coverage. The possibility of unknown visitors is very low. No clash with neighbours was reported. The time of the murder can be ascertained only after a postmortem. We received information by 7pm and arrived at the spot.”
